Welcome to District Rico

District Rico is a Peruvian restaurant located in Washington, DC, offering a variety of dishes such as quarter and half chicken meals, family specials, and flavorful burritos. The menu includes vegan and vegetarian options, with a focus on quality and generous portions. Customers rave about the tender and flavorful chicken, delicious sauces, and diverse side dishes like plantains and yuca fries. The casual ambiance, friendly service, and affordable prices make District Rico a must-visit spot for Peruvian cuisine enthusiasts. The restaurant's convenient location and positive reviews guarantee a satisfying dining experience for all.

District Rico is a Peruvian restaurant located in Washington, DC, offering a wide range of options for dining-in, takeout, and delivery. With a menu that includes vegan and vegetarian options, this casual eatery is perfect for a quick lunch or a relaxed dinner. The restaurant also offers catering services, making it a great choice for groups or special events.

One of the standout dishes at District Rico is their Peruvian chicken, which has received rave reviews from customers. The chicken is tender, flavorful, and perfectly seasoned, served with a variety of delicious sauces. Customers also praise the generous portion sizes and the selection of sides, such as plantains, yuca fries, and chickpeas.

In addition to their signature chicken dishes, District Rico also offers burritos with a choice of chicken, beef, or veggie fillings. These burritos are packed with rice, black beans, guacamole, cheese, and sour cream, making for a satisfying and hearty meal.

Overall, the ambiance at District Rico is welcoming and clean, with friendly staff and fast service. The restaurant is also dog-friendly and offers outdoor seating, making it a great spot to enjoy a meal with your furry friend. Whether you're a fan of Peruvian cuisine or just looking for a flavorful and satisfying meal, District Rico is a must-try in the DC area.
